Obsah:

LOG WiFi Analyzer: 4 kroky
LOG WiFi Analyzer: 4 kroky

Video: LOG WiFi Analyzer: 4 kroky

Video: LOG WiFi Analyzer: 4 kroky
Video: Как очистить память, не удаляя ничего НУЖНОГО? 4 вида мусорных файлов, которые надо УДАЛИТЬ. 2024, Červenec
Anonim
LOG WiFi analyzátor
LOG WiFi analyzátor
LOG WiFi analyzátor
LOG WiFi analyzátor

Našel jsem tento částečně zahájený projekt z doby před několika lety. Nejsem si jistý, proč jsem to nikdy nepředložil, ale pokusím se to udělat nyní.

Takže druhý rok tento Lazy Old Geek (L. O. G.) našel tento Instructable:

www.instructables.com/id/ESP8266-WiFi-Anal…

Myslím, že autor odvedl skvělou práci, a tak jsem se rozhodl vytvořit si vlastní.

Použil NodeMCU ESP8266. Žádný jsem neměl, ale myslím, že vycházejí z ESP-12. ESP-07 je velmi podobný ESP-12, takže jsem si jich pár objednal. Koupil jsem také několik 2mm samčích záhlaví a několik samičích záhlaví, takže jsem nainstaloval zástrčkové hlavice na ESP-07 a vzal jsem samičí kolíkové lišty a dal na ně nějaké dráty, aby se vešly do prkénka. (Viz obrázek)

Krok 1: Hardware:

Hardware
Hardware
Hardware
Hardware

Místo Nodemcu jsem použil ESP-07.

Můj displej je 2,8”displej ILI9341 pravděpodobně zakoupený na ebay. Je o něco větší než ten v originále.

Krok 2: Deska s plošnými spoji

Tištěný spoj
Tištěný spoj
Tištěný spoj
Tištěný spoj

Dobře, navrhl jsem desku plošných spojů s napájením 3,3 V, kolíky 2,2 mm pro ESP-07 a konektorem pro displej.

V příloze jsou soubory Eagle Cadsoft, které jsem použil k výrobě DPS a schématu.

UPOZORNĚNÍ: Schéma na obrázku nesouhlasí se soubory Eagle. Soubory Eagle jsem ztratil pomocí regulátoru AMS1117 3.3V zobrazeného na tomto obrázku.

Připojené soubory Eagle používají diodu 1N5817 k poklesu napětí 5v na 4,4 (?) V pro ESP-07. Zdá se, že moje nastavení funguje dobře, ale vím, že je mimo specifikaci. Nedoporučuji používat diodu (a nejsem si jistý, proč jsem to udělal).

Pokud jste náhodou chtěli použít tyto soubory Eagle, pak jste pravděpodobně schopni provést změny. Změňte schéma a desku, abyste použili regulátor 3,3 V.

Tato PCB také vyžaduje USB-Serial adaptér s RTS a DTR, jak je vysvětleno v tomto Instructable:

www.instructables.com/id/ESP-07-Test-PCB/

Krok 3: Skica Arduino

Skica Arduino
Skica Arduino

Toto jsou knihovny, které jsem použil pro 2,8”displej:

Knihovny: Stahujte soubory zip:

github.com/adafruit/Adafruit_ILI9341

github.com/adafruit/Adafruit-GFX-Library

Spusťte Arduino:

Klikněte na

Najděte výše uvedené soubory zip, otevřete je a stáhněte

Aktuálně používám verzi Arduino 1.8.1.12.

Nejjednodušší způsob, jak nainstalovat ESP8266, je použít Board Manager pomocí této metody:

github.com/esp8266/Arduino#installing-with…

Když jsem prováděl nějaké testování s ESP-07, vybral jsem „Obecný modul ESP8266“.

www.instructables.com/id/ESP-07-Test-PCB/

U této skici to však nefungovalo, takže u desek pod nadpisem ESP8266 (2.6.3) vyberte NodeMCU 0.9 (modul ESP-12 nebo NodeMCU 1.0 (modul ESP-12)

Výchozí nastavení desky vypadá, že funguje dobře.

Ano, vím, že to není ESP-12, ale myslím, že jsou dostatečně blízko, aby to fungovalo.

Myslím, že jsem přepsal původní kód WiFiAnalyzer, ale nevím, co jsem změnil. Může to být kvůli mému zobrazení nebo rozdílům mezi ESP-07 a NodeMCU. V každém případě to funguje, ale kredit jde původci.

Můj kód je připojen: MTSWiFi.ino.

Krok 4: Některé vzpomínky + závěr

Některé vzpomínky + závěr
Některé vzpomínky + závěr
Některé vzpomínky + závěr
Některé vzpomínky + závěr
Některé vzpomínky + závěr
Některé vzpomínky + závěr

Všiml jsem si něco o ESP-07 na této desce. Keramická anténa je odstraněna a k externí anténě je připojen kabel. Keramická anténa je odstraněna, takže pokud jsou současně připojeny dvě antény, nedochází k neshodě signálu. Mým plánem bylo umístit na něj směrovou anténu, abych viděl, odkud každý signál přichází.

Nechal jsem to připojit k směrovací patch anténě, viz další obrázky.

Myslím, že jsem mohl mít anténu namontovanou na stativu.

Výsledky si nepamatuji. Mám podezření, že byli v zásadě bezvýznamní, takže jsem možná od té myšlenky upustil.

Tak jsem se dnes něco naučil. Vzal jsem vzorek z mého LOG Wifi analyzátoru (viz přiložený) a další z mého Smartphone WiFi Analyzer (viz přiložený)

Významným rozdílem je NVR9ca3a93 na kanálu 14.

Poté, co jsem o tom spal, měl jsem chvilku Eureka, provedl jsem malý průzkum:

en.wikipedia.org/wiki/List_of_WLAN_channel…

Jak ukazuje tabulka, Severní Amerika nepovoluje kanály 12–14. To tedy vysvětluje, proč to můj chytrý telefon nezobrazuje a evidentně ano analyzátor LOG WiFi.

Co to nevysvětluje, je to, co je WiFi zařízení s SSID NVR9ca3a93?

Udělám předpoklad, že toto je SSP ESP-07 v mém analyzátoru LOG WiFi.

TIP: Jedna věc, kterou vím, je, že ESP-03, které mám, mají SSID AI_Thinker. Jak je vidět na obrázcích, toto je ten v mých IP hodinách. Tipuji tedy, že ESP-07 mají NVR ?? SSID.

Závěr: Přes všechny neznámé a pochybnosti tento WiFi Analyzer funguje.

Doporučuje: